Day 5 Germination


Here you can see our Pea and Bean seeds. Today, we transplanted them into soil. 
We will have a control group (Pea #2 and Bean #2) and experimental group (Pea #1 and 
Bean #1). The question is Which seed will have the most growth? Why?
One will be limited with sun exposure but will have a "sun roof". What happens? We will
keep you posted!

Which gave us more information?

For the past few weeks, we have been starting each new Shared Reading Book with a glance of looking at the cover and listening to the title of the book. Then, we predict what kinds of words we might encounter within the text. Today, we charted those words in black, based only on the cover and the title. Then, we did our Book Walk. This is when we "walk through the book and look at the pictures to predict what the story is about. However, today, the focus was on what kinds of words we might encounter as we read the book. Those words are charted in blue.  After reading the book, we realized that our predictions were more accurate by doing the book walk than only looking at the cover and title of the book.  This reinforces how important it is to preview a book before reading!
